Commit graph

3 commits

Author SHA1 Message Date
Danny Stocker
e005585c1d Clarify community project status and licensing
Some checks failed
CI / test (3.11) (push) Has been cancelled
CI / test (3.12) (push) Has been cancelled
Following feedback about potentially misleading "Official" claims:

**README.md:**
- Removed "Official" from first line
- Added clear disclaimer: community project proposing what an official CLI could look like
- Not affiliated with or endorsed by OpenWebUI team
- Added note on MIT vs BSD-3-Clause license difference

**docs/RFC.md:**
- Added prominent disclaimer at top
- Changed status from "Implementation-Ready" to "Community Proposal"
- Made clear this is a proposal, not a claim of official status
- Added "if OpenWebUI team isn't interested, that's fine" acknowledgment

The intent was always to propose, not to mislead. Language now reflects that accurately.

Co-Authored-By: Claude <noreply@anthropic.com>
2025-12-01 10:52:54 +01:00
Danny Stocker
59c36403b5 docs: align scope and add community scaffolding 2025-12-01 04:24:51 +01:00
Danny Stocker
8530f74687 Initial CLI scaffolding with v1.0 MVP structure
Complete Python CLI for OpenWebUI with:
- Auth commands (login, logout, whoami, token, refresh)
- Chat send with streaming support
- RAG files/collections management
- Models list/info
- Admin stats (minimal v1.0)
- Config management with profiles and keyring

Stack: typer, httpx, rich, pydantic, keyring

Based on RFC v1.2 with 22-step implementation checklist

🤖 Generated with [Claude Code](https://claude.com/claude-code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-11-30 20:09:19 +01:00